Summary of the Disciplinary Proceedings Against George Abaraonye at the Oxford Union

In a recent development, the Oxford Union has announced that President-elect George Abaraonye will face disciplinary actions following his inappropriate celebration of the murder of political commentator Charlie Kirk. This incident has sparked significant outrage, leading to public calls for accountability from various factions within the university community.

Background of the Incident

The controversy began when George Abaraonye publicly expressed joy over the murder of Charlie Kirk, a well-known figure associated with conservative politics. The comments made by Abaraonye were deemed "vile" by many, igniting a firestorm of criticism on social media platforms. Nicholas Lissack, a prominent figure in the discussion, took to Twitter to voice his concerns, emphasizing the importance of holding institutions accountable for their leaders’ actions. His tweet garnered attention and support from various users, illustrating the collective disapproval of Abaraonye’s behavior.

Institutional Response

The Oxford Union’s decision to initiate disciplinary proceedings against Abaraonye is seen as a direct response to the public outcry generated by this incident. Many believe that such actions are necessary to uphold the values of respect and dignity within the institution. The Oxford Union, known for its debates and discussions on various topics, has a responsibility to maintain a standard of conduct among its members, especially when it comes to sensitive issues like violence and political discourse.
